One common issue is simply using an incompatible OBD2 scanner. While OBD2 is a standardized system, not all scanners are created equal, and some may not fully support the Ford communication protocols used in the 2013 Transit Connect. Generic, cheaper scanners, especially Bluetooth OBD2 adapters found online, might not always work. The original poster in a forum recommended a specific BAFX Products Bluetooth OBD2 scan tool for its compatibility with Ford vehicles. This highlights the importance of choosing a scanner known to work with your vehicle’s make and model.
If you’re using an Android device, apps like ForScan are highly recommended for Ford vehicles. ForScan is a powerful, yet affordable tool available on the Google Play store that can read ABS codes and access deeper diagnostic information compared to generic OBD2 apps. To use ForScan, you’ll need a compatible Bluetooth OBD2 connector. As mentioned, the BAFX Products adapter is a confirmed compatible option. ForScan is particularly useful because it is designed specifically for Ford, Mazda, Lincoln, and Mercury vehicles, giving you more reliable access to your Transit Connect’s systems.
Beyond basic code reading, apps like Torque Pro, also for Android, expand your diagnostic capabilities. For around $30, Torque Pro allows you to monitor a wide range of parameters (PIDs) in real-time, such as transmission temperature and boost pressure. This eliminates the need for installing separate gauges for many common monitoring needs. While you might still need dedicated gauges for things like Exhaust Gas Temperature (EGT) or fuel pressure, Torque Pro provides a convenient way to keep an eye on many critical vehicle systems directly from your smartphone or tablet.
For those seeking a more comprehensive, professional-grade diagnostic tool, options like AutoEnginuity are available. However, as the original poster pointed out, using Android-based solutions like ForScan and Torque Pro can be much more convenient for quick checks. Since most people carry their smartphones with them, using a Bluetooth OBD2 adapter and a phone app is often faster and easier than getting out a laptop and a more complex diagnostic system just to read a code or monitor a sensor.
Finally, a crucial tip when working with OBD2 scanners on your 2013 Transit Connect: always pull and clear codes with the engine turned off. Attempting to do so with the engine running can sometimes cause the engine to stall. This issue may occur because some scanners try to retrieve the Vehicle Identification Number (VIN) using a PID that is not supported, leading to communication problems and potential engine disruption. By ensuring the engine is off when initiating code reading or clearing, you can avoid this potential problem and ensure a smoother diagnostic process.
